Local domains are definitely important if you are worried about SEO.The
rules on .au domains are a lot looser nowadays as well, which makes things
easier.

.com is good for showing that you are playing on the world stage :)

Domains are so cheap now that I always (if I can) register both the .com and
.com.au of
whatever I am doing.
